(LĐ online) - Lam Dong Provincial People's Committee has just issued a Decision approving the auction results of more than 6,200m3 of sand as evidence of a criminal case, earning more than 2.1 billion VND.

Accordingly, the winning bidder is Dinh Tam Company Limited, located at Dinh Van Industrial Cluster, Tan Lam village, Da Don commune, Lam Ha district with the winning bid amount of VND 2,165,328,000.
The Provincial People's Committee assigned the Department of Finance to take full responsibility before the law and the Provincial People's Committee for the publicity, transparency, honesty, objectivity and the process and procedures for the auction of 6,210.170 m3 of sand (evidence of the criminal case) that has been appraised and submitted for approval.
Previously, in 2023, the police caught Khong Van Quy (37 years old), residing in Nam Ban town, Lam Ha district, illegally mining sand under the Da Cho Mo hydroelectric reservoir, in Phi To commune, Lam Ha district. At the scene, the authorities recorded more than 400m3 of sand being gathered along the shore waiting to be sold. Through investigation, Lam Dong Provincial Police determined that from January to September 2023, Khong Van Quy illegally mined sand.
After that, Quy sold a part to organizations and individuals in Da Lat city, Lam Ha district and Duc Trong district. The remaining sand was gathered at 3 locations in Phi To commune with a volume of more than 6,210m3 . Expanding the investigation of the case, Lam Dong Provincial Police prosecuted and detained Ca Duc Hom (51 years old), former Chairman of Phi To commune People's Committee, Chairman of Nam Ha commune People's Committee; Nhan The Anh (41 years old), Vice Chairman of Phi To commune People's Committee and 2 other officials under the Phi To commune People's Committee.
